i have no problem admitting im wrong, but you wont get 340-350rwhp with the mods you have. unless your running the cutout and borla open. even 330rwhp is a bit generious assuming your around 300rwhp stock. 98-99' gain the most with shorties but even at that there almost not worth the swap. the jba's arent even 1 3/4 if i remember right. the Y pipe aint worth much either over the stock one especially only at 2.5" diameter. FRA, MAF de-screen, TB bypass, TB bumpstop shaved, K&N, 160 PwrStat, bellows, NGK-TR6, and 8.5mm Magnacor wires are worth maybe 10rwhp. your only saving grace is the borla Adj w/Q-tech elec cutout. and dont kid yourself about the superships "tune"

im not degrading your ride and apologize if it comes off that way, im just telling you like it is. i think your are way optimistic at 340rwhp/350rwtq.

320 rwhp isn't ****! Especially with nothing major done on an older car. Newer cars do better due mostly to having better manifolds (probably flow almost as well as your shorties) and the LS6 intake manifold. At 320 rwhp, if you assume say 15% drivetrain loss that is 375 flywheel hp. That's not too shabby. (at 12% loss it's still like 365 flywheel, but I like to assume 15% ) Look at my car!!! 98 Z28 A4 with LONGtube headers, true duals, no cats, and a lid. What did I make?? 320/337!!!
